Could you advise the proper procedure to add the GM coolant stop leak pellets?


The car is a 98 Deville with the 4.6 Northstar engine.


I have read that adding them to the coolant reservoir is incorrect.

True, you don't want to simply dump them into the reservoir. They'll never make it to the engine. You should put them in the lower radiator hose prior to refilling the system. I've heard some people claim that crushing them is better but to my knowledge the OEM does NOT recommend that be done.
